Starting in 606 B.C.E., with Jerusalem and its temple lying in ruins hundreds of miles away, Ezekiel focuses on a message of hope —the thrilling … TīmeklisGod says that the soul who sins is the one who bears the guilt and dies (Ezekiel 18:1-4). God affirms that a righteous man shall live. He will not die because of another’s guilt (Ezekiel 18:5-9). If that righteous man has a wicked son, that son is guilty, not the father (Ezekiel 18:10-13). If the wicked son in turn has a son who is righteous ...
